Boost Your Website's SEO: A Comprehensive Guide
Hey guys! Ever feel like your website is a hidden gem, but nobody's finding it? Well, you're not alone. In today's digital world, having a stunning website is only half the battle. The other half? Making sure people can actually find it. That's where SEO, or Search Engine Optimization, comes in. Think of it as the secret sauce that helps your website climb the ranks on search engines like Google. In this comprehensive guide, we're diving deep into the world of SEO, breaking down everything you need to know to boost your website's visibility and attract more traffic. We'll cover the core components, from understanding keywords and crafting compelling content to building backlinks and navigating the ever-changing landscape of search engine algorithms. So, buckle up, because we're about to embark on a journey to SEO success!
What is SEO and Why Does it Matter?
Alright, let's start with the basics. SEO, at its core, is the practice of optimizing your website to rank higher in search engine results pages (SERPs). When someone searches for a term related to your business, SEO aims to get your website to show up prominently. Why does this matter? Because higher rankings mean more visibility, which translates to more clicks, more traffic, and ultimately, more potential customers. Think about it: when you search for something, how often do you scroll past the first page of results? Probably not often, right? That's why being on the first page, and ideally in the top few positions, is crucial. It's the digital equivalent of prime real estate. SEO isn't just about technical tweaks and keyword stuffing; it's about providing value to your audience. It's about creating high-quality content that answers their questions, solves their problems, and keeps them coming back for more. In a nutshell, SEO helps you:
- Increase Organic Traffic: Attract visitors who are genuinely interested in what you offer, as they are actively searching for it.
- Improve Brand Awareness: Enhance your online visibility and establish your brand as a credible source of information.
- Generate Leads and Conversions: Convert website visitors into customers or clients, ultimately driving business growth.
- Establish Authority: Position yourself as an expert in your industry, building trust and credibility with your audience.
So, if you're serious about growing your online presence and reaching your target audience, understanding and implementing SEO strategies is no longer optional; it's essential.
The Pillars of Effective SEO
Now, let's dive into the core components that make up a successful SEO strategy. There are several key areas you need to focus on to get your website ranking higher. One of the initial pillars includes keyword research. Keywords are the foundation of SEO. They're the words and phrases people use when searching for information online. The research process is identifying relevant keywords that your target audience is using. Tools like Google Keyword Planner, SEMrush, and Ahrefs can help you discover popular and relevant keywords for your business. When selecting keywords, consider search volume (how often people search for a term), competition (how many other websites are targeting the same keywords), and relevance (how closely the keyword relates to your content and offerings). Once you've identified your target keywords, the next step is to integrate them into your website content, including page titles, headings, body text, image alt tags, and meta descriptions. However, it's essential to do so naturally, avoiding keyword stuffing, which can harm your rankings. Focus on creating high-quality, informative content that resonates with your audience while incorporating your target keywords. This way, Google will see your website as a good match for the search and start boosting your visibility. Also, don't forget about on-page optimization. This involves optimizing elements within your website to improve its search engine ranking. Key aspects of on-page optimization include:
- Title Tags and Meta Descriptions: Craft compelling title tags and meta descriptions that accurately describe your page content and include relevant keywords. These elements appear in search results and influence click-through rates.
- Header Tags: Use header tags (H1, H2, H3, etc.) to structure your content logically and highlight important keywords.
- Image Optimization: Optimize your images by using descriptive file names and alt tags that include relevant keywords. This helps search engines understand the context of your images.
- Internal Linking: Link to other relevant pages within your website to improve navigation and distribute link juice, which is the value passed from one page to another.
Content Creation and Optimization
Content is king, as the saying goes, and in the world of SEO, this couldn't be truer. Creating high-quality, engaging, and informative content is critical for attracting and retaining visitors. It's also a key factor in improving your search engine rankings. Start by understanding your target audience and what they're searching for. Conduct keyword research to identify topics that align with your audience's interests and business goals. There are various content formats you can use, including:
- Blog Posts: Share informative articles, how-to guides, and thought leadership pieces related to your industry.
- Videos: Create video tutorials, product demos, or interviews to engage your audience visually.
- Infographics: Present complex information in an easy-to-understand and visually appealing format.
- Ebooks and Whitepapers: Offer in-depth resources to establish your authority and generate leads.
When creating content, focus on providing real value to your audience. Answer their questions, solve their problems, and offer unique insights. Optimize your content for search engines by including relevant keywords in your headings, body text, and image alt tags. Ensure your content is well-structured, easy to read, and mobile-friendly. Regularly update your content to keep it fresh and relevant. The more valuable content you provide, the more likely people are to share it, link to it, and engage with it, all of which can positively impact your SEO efforts. Finally, don't underestimate the power of technical SEO. This refers to optimizing the technical aspects of your website to improve its search engine ranking and user experience. Some of the key aspects include:
- Website Speed: Ensure your website loads quickly, as slow-loading websites can negatively impact user experience and search engine rankings. Use tools like Google PageSpeed Insights to identify and fix speed-related issues.
- Mobile-Friendliness: Make sure your website is responsive and looks great on all devices, as mobile-friendliness is a ranking factor for Google.
- Site Architecture: Organize your website's structure logically, making it easy for both users and search engines to navigate. Use a clear and consistent navigation menu and internal linking strategy.
- HTTPS: Secure your website with HTTPS to protect user data and signal to search engines that your site is secure.
- XML Sitemap: Submit an XML sitemap to search engines to help them crawl and index your website effectively.
Off-Page SEO: Building Authority and Credibility
While on-page optimization focuses on elements within your website, off-page SEO involves activities that take place outside of your website to build its authority and credibility. One of the crucial components of off-page SEO is backlink building. Backlinks are links from other websites to your website. They are a vote of confidence from other websites and are a key ranking factor for search engines. The more high-quality backlinks you have, the more authority and credibility your website will have in the eyes of search engines. Building backlinks involves reaching out to other websites and requesting links to your content. There are various strategies for building backlinks, including:
- Guest Blogging: Write and publish guest posts on other websites in your industry, including a link back to your website in your author bio.
- Broken Link Building: Find broken links on other websites and suggest your content as a replacement.
- Resource Page Link Building: Identify resource pages on other websites and request that your content be added as a valuable resource.
- Creating Linkable Assets: Develop valuable content, such as infographics, ebooks, and videos, that other websites will want to link to.
When building backlinks, focus on acquiring links from reputable and relevant websites. Avoid low-quality or spammy links, as they can harm your search engine rankings. Another important aspect of off-page SEO is social media marketing. Social media can help boost your SEO efforts by:
- Increasing Brand Awareness: Expand your reach and expose your content to a wider audience.
- Driving Traffic to Your Website: Share your content on social media platforms, including a link back to your website.
- Building Relationships: Engage with your audience and build relationships with other influencers in your industry.
- Improving Search Engine Rankings: While social signals are not a direct ranking factor, social media activity can indirectly impact your search engine rankings by driving traffic to your website and increasing brand awareness.
Monitoring, Analysis and Adaptation
Alright guys, we've covered a lot, but the work doesn't stop here. SEO is not a one-time task; it's an ongoing process. To ensure your SEO efforts are successful, you need to monitor your performance, analyze the results, and adapt your strategies accordingly. Use tools like Google Analytics and Google Search Console to track your website's traffic, keyword rankings, and other key metrics. These tools provide valuable insights into how users are interacting with your website and what search terms they're using to find you. You can use this data to identify areas where you're succeeding and areas where you need to improve. When it comes to analyzing your data, look for trends and patterns. Are there specific keywords that are driving more traffic? Are there pages that are underperforming? Are there any technical issues that are affecting your website's rankings? Use this information to refine your SEO strategy. Adapt your strategies based on the insights you gain from your analysis. SEO is a dynamic field, and search engine algorithms are constantly evolving. What worked last year may not work this year. Regularly update your content, adjust your keyword strategy, and optimize your website based on the latest best practices.
Tools for Success
There's a bunch of tools that will help you. Here are some of them:
- Google Analytics: A powerful web analytics service that tracks and reports website traffic.
- Google Search Console: Provides insights into your website's performance in Google search results.
- Google Keyword Planner: A free tool for researching keywords and analyzing search volume.
- SEMrush: A comprehensive SEO tool that provides keyword research, competitor analysis, and website audit features.
- Ahrefs: Another powerful SEO tool that offers keyword research, backlink analysis, and competitor analysis features.
- Moz Pro: An SEO tool that provides keyword research, rank tracking, and site audit features.
- Yoast SEO: A popular WordPress plugin that helps you optimize your website content for SEO.
- Rank Math: Another popular WordPress plugin that offers similar SEO features as Yoast SEO.
Staying Ahead of the Curve
SEO is constantly changing, so staying informed about the latest trends and best practices is crucial for long-term success. Follow industry blogs, attend webinars, and participate in online communities to stay up-to-date. Be ready to adapt and refine your strategy based on the latest information. Embrace new technologies and strategies as they emerge. As search engine algorithms continue to evolve, new opportunities and challenges will arise. Stay curious, be willing to experiment, and never stop learning. By following these principles, you can ensure your website stays visible in the search results and continues to attract the traffic it deserves. By the way, SEO is a long-term game. It takes time and effort to see results. Don't get discouraged if you don't see immediate improvements. Stay consistent with your efforts, and you'll eventually reap the rewards. Remember that consistency, patience, and a commitment to providing value are the keys to long-term SEO success. So get out there, start optimizing, and watch your website climb the ranks! Good luck, and happy optimizing!